Bonin Woodpigeon

ボニンバト(Columba versicolor)— 小笠原諸島(父島)原産とされるが絶滅種。19世紀に最後の記録が残る。

Adamawa Turtle-dove

Medium dove, 27–30 cm, with warm rufous-brown upperparts, a black neck collar, and a deep orange-red breast. Endemic to the highland plateaus and montane grasslands of northern Nigeria and Cameroon. Granivore of grass seeds and cultivated grains. Poorly studied and localised range. Least Concern.
